Uncontrolled airport runway lights

Featured Replies

Apologies if this has been covered in the past; I've searched the forums but could not find anything on this topic.

 

Landing at uncontrolled airports at night. Is there a way to activate the runway lights in FSX such as in the real-world by keying the radio?

 

Any info will be appreciated!

 

Thanks!

If the airport has lighting, it will always be on in FSX at night. If there is no lighting, it is because the AFCAD or default scenery for that airport doesn't have it listed. Wether its uncontrolled or not does not matter, the lights are dependent on the scenery file.

 

However on that note, there have been some scenery developers which have implementated PAL (Pilot Activated Lighting) into their scenery where tuning a frequency will turn the lights on. This isn't completely realistic as in real life you have to PTT 3 times for it to active the PAL (and then usually an automatic voice will say 'Airport Lights Activated').
